网络设备监控平台如何进行性能测试?

随着互联网技术的飞速发展,网络设备在各个行业中的应用越来越广泛。为了保证网络设备的稳定运行,网络设备监控平台应运而生。然而,如何对网络设备监控平台进行性能测试,以确保其稳定性和可靠性,成为了许多企业关注的焦点。本文将深入探讨网络设备监控平台如何进行性能测试,以期为相关企业提供参考。

一、性能测试概述

性能测试是指通过模拟实际运行环境,对系统或应用程序进行压力、负载、性能等方面的测试,以评估其性能指标是否满足预期要求。网络设备监控平台性能测试主要包括以下几个方面:

  1. 响应时间测试:测试网络设备监控平台对用户请求的响应时间,以评估其处理速度。
  2. 并发用户测试:模拟多个用户同时访问网络设备监控平台,测试其并发处理能力。
  3. 稳定性测试:在长时间运行的情况下,测试网络设备监控平台的稳定性,确保其不会出现崩溃、死机等问题。
  4. 负载测试:在特定负载条件下,测试网络设备监控平台的性能表现,以评估其在高负载环境下的表现。

二、性能测试方法

  1. 压力测试:通过不断增加压力,测试网络设备监控平台在极限条件下的性能表现。例如,可以模拟大量用户同时访问平台,观察平台是否能够正常响应。

  2. 负载测试:在正常使用场景下,模拟一定数量的用户同时访问平台,测试其性能表现。例如,可以模拟100个用户同时访问平台,观察平台的响应时间、并发处理能力等。

  3. 性能分析:通过分析网络设备监控平台的运行日志、性能指标等数据,找出性能瓶颈,并进行优化。

  4. 对比测试:将网络设备监控平台与其他同类产品进行对比测试,以评估其性能优劣。

三、性能测试工具

  1. JMeter:一款开源的负载测试工具,适用于各种Web应用、服务器、网络等性能测试。

  2. LoadRunner:一款功能强大的性能测试工具,支持多种平台和协议,适用于各种性能测试场景。

  3. Gatling:一款高性能的Web性能测试工具,适用于Web应用、移动应用等性能测试。

四、案例分析

以某企业网络设备监控平台为例,该平台主要用于监控企业内部网络设备的运行状态。在性能测试过程中,企业采用了以下方法:

  1. 压力测试:模拟500个用户同时访问平台,观察平台的响应时间、并发处理能力等。测试结果显示,平台在压力条件下仍能保持良好的性能表现。

  2. 负载测试:在正常使用场景下,模拟100个用户同时访问平台,观察平台的性能表现。测试结果显示,平台的响应时间、并发处理能力等指标均符合预期。

  3. 性能分析:通过分析平台的运行日志、性能指标等数据,发现平台在高并发情况下存在性能瓶颈。针对该问题,企业对平台进行了优化,提高了平台的性能表现。

通过以上案例,可以看出,网络设备监控平台性能测试对于确保其稳定运行具有重要意义。企业应重视性能测试,并根据实际情况选择合适的测试方法、工具,以提高平台的性能表现。

总之,网络设备监控平台性能测试是保证其稳定运行的关键环节。通过采用合适的测试方法、工具,企业可以及时发现平台性能问题,并进行优化,从而提高平台的性能表现。希望本文对相关企业有所帮助。

猜你喜欢:微服务监控